2 definitions found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Protozoic \Pro`to*zo"ic\, a. 1. (Zool.) Of or pertaining to the Protozoa. [1913 Webster] 2. (Geol.) Containing remains of the earliest discovered life of the globe, which included mollusks, radiates and protozoans. [1913 Webster] From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: protozoic adj : of or relating to the Protozoa [syn: {protozoal}, {protozoan}]
